The server character set of non-object name character fields in the Data Dictionary is Latin. These fields (for example, CHAR(1) or CHAR(2)) have a fixed set of values (for example, Y, N, A, CV, and so on) and contain characters from U+0020 to U+007F (for example, A is U+0041).
